ACS participates in Cards Asia 2012

May 7, 2012

HONG KONG, 7 May, 2012 - Advanced Card Systems Ltd. (ACS, wholly owned subsidiary of Advanced Card Systems Holdings Ltd., SEHK: 8210), Asia Pacific's number 1 supplier and one of the world's top 3 suppliers of PC-linked smart card readers (Source: Frost & Sullivan), was present to showcase its Near Field Communication (NFC) solutions and knowhow during the exhibition and conference at Cards and Payments Asia 2012 in Singapore. ACS Regional Sales Manager, Mr. Gordon Lee; and ACS Assistant Product Marketing Manager, Ms. Richelle Arjona, took over the reins for ACS in the conference as they delivered speeches about NFC.

Gordon discussed NFC in relation to RFID and smart card technology. With the title “Is NFC equal to RFID? How to leverage NFC with smart card technology?”, his discussion enlightened the audience about NFC’s role as a subset of RFID technology, and as the current hottest commodity in the contactless industry. Gordon explained the three modes of NFC, namely, the reader/writer, card emulation and peer-to-peer communication modes. The last two modes of which are what separate NFC from traditional RFID devices. Likewise, he enumerated the various form factors where NFC can be built, showing how flexible and versatile the technology is in terms of practical applications. In conclusion to his presentation, Gordon showed the effects of NFC to the smart card technology industry, explaining that the growth of the former results to more demands in card and reader deployments for the latter.

On the other hand, Richelle’s presentation, entitled “NFC: Why is it for me?”, dealt with the definition and prevailing market trends of NFC technology, underscoring the role of NFC in the age of converging technologies. She provided various examples of how the components of this technology, including contactless cards and readers, are used to make daily transactions much easier, particularly within the sectors of transportation and payment. Richelle also highlighted the role of ACS in today’s growing NFC industry by showing a number of project references illustrating ACS’s successful NFC deployments throughout the world. Through these topics, she was able to demonstrate the applicability of NFC in everyone’s daily undertakings.

One of Asia’s biggest events for the cards sector, Cards and Payments Asia was held this year at the Suntec Singapore International Convention & Exhibition Centre in Singapore from the 25th to the 27th of April, 2012. ACS took advantage of this gigantic platform for industry players and consumers alike by showcasing its existing dynamic range of NFC readers, namely, the ACR122U NFC Contactless Smart Card Reader, ACR1222L VisualVantage NFC Reader with LCD and ACR122T Contactless Smart Card Reader, as well as the ACR1251U CCID-compliant NFC Reader, which is expected to be released this year.
